游戏文件哈希值不匹配,常见原因及解决方法游戏文件哈希值不匹配

游戏文件哈希值不匹配,常见原因及解决方法游戏文件哈希值不匹配,

本文目录导读:

  1. 什么是文件哈希值
  2. 游戏文件哈希值不匹配的原因
  3. 游戏文件哈希值不匹配的解决方法

在现代游戏中,文件哈希值不匹配是一个非常常见的问题,尤其是在游戏更新或重新安装时,哈希值是文件数据的一个唯一标识符,用于确保文件的完整性和真实性,如果游戏文件的哈希值不匹配,可能意味着文件在传输或存储过程中被篡改、损坏或丢失,这将导致游戏无法正常运行或出现各种异常问题,本文将详细分析游戏文件哈希值不匹配的原因,并提供相应的解决方法。

什么是文件哈希值

哈希值是一种用于唯一标识文件的数据值,通常由一系列数字和字母组成,它通过将文件的所有内容经过特定的数学算法处理,生成一个固定长度的字符串,哈希值具有强抗干扰性,即使文件内容 slightest的改变,哈希值也会发生显著的变化。

在游戏领域,哈希值被用来验证游戏文件的完整性,游戏开发商会在发布游戏时,计算游戏文件的哈希值,并将其公开,玩家在安装游戏时,可以通过重新计算文件的哈希值,与公开的哈希值进行对比,确保自己下载的文件与官方文件完全一致。

游戏文件哈希值不匹配的原因

文件损坏或篡改

文件损坏或篡改是导致哈希值不匹配的常见原因,在文件传输过程中,由于网络不稳定、网络攻击或设备故障,文件可能会被损坏或篡改,损坏的文件在重新计算哈希值时,将与原始文件的哈希值不一致。

有些玩家可能会将多个版本的游戏文件混用,导致哈希值不匹配,如果一个玩家同时安装了两个不同的游戏版本,其中一个版本的文件哈希值与官方文件不匹配,这将导致游戏无法正常运行。

文件完整性问题

文件完整性问题也是导致哈希值不匹配的原因之一,有些情况下,游戏文件可能被部分删除、丢失或被替换,游戏安装完成后,玩家可能会删除部分文件,导致哈希值计算出错。

有些第三方工具或修改程序可能会修改游戏文件,导致文件的哈希值发生变化,这些工具可能被用于修改游戏内容,但它们通常会改变文件的哈希值,使得玩家在安装后发现哈希值不匹配。

版本冲突

版本冲突是导致哈希值不匹配的另一个原因,在游戏开发中,不同版本的游戏文件可能会有不同的哈希值,如果玩家同时安装了多个版本的游戏文件,其中一个版本的文件哈希值与官方文件不匹配,这将导致游戏无法正常运行。

有些游戏可能会发布多个更新版本,每个版本的文件哈希值都不同,如果玩家没有正确安装更新版本,或者安装了多个版本的更新文件,这将导致哈希值不匹配。

系统环境问题

游戏文件的哈希值不匹配可能与系统的环境设置有关,某些系统设置或驱动程序的不兼容可能导致哈希值计算出错。

操作系统版本的更新也可能导致哈希值不匹配,如果玩家的操作系统版本与游戏官方要求的版本不兼容,这可能会影响游戏文件的哈希值。

游戏文件哈希值不匹配的解决方法

检查文件完整性

玩家需要检查游戏文件的完整性,可以通过以下方法验证游戏文件的哈希值:

  • 使用MD5校验工具重新计算文件的哈希值,并与官方提供的哈希值进行对比。
  • 确保游戏文件完整无损,没有被损坏或篡改。

备份和重新下载文件

如果发现游戏文件的哈希值不匹配,玩家可以尝试备份当前的游戏文件,然后从官方网站或游戏开发商的网站重新下载完整的游戏文件,重新下载后,重新安装游戏并验证哈希值。

检查系统设置

游戏文件的哈希值不匹配可能与系统的设置有关,玩家需要检查以下内容:

  • 确保系统设置与游戏官方要求的版本一致。
  • 确保所有驱动程序和系统软件都是最新版本。

联系游戏开发商或技术支持

如果经过上述步骤,仍然无法解决哈希值不匹配的问题,玩家可以联系游戏开发商或技术支持寻求帮助,游戏开发商通常会提供详细的解决方案,或者重新发布正确的游戏文件。

游戏文件哈希值不匹配是游戏安装过程中常见的问题,可能由文件损坏、完整性问题、版本冲突或系统环境问题引起,解决这个问题需要玩家仔细检查文件的完整性,重新下载和安装游戏,并与官方提供的哈希值进行对比,如果问题无法解决,建议联系游戏开发商或技术支持,寻求进一步的帮助,通过以上方法,玩家可以有效避免游戏文件哈希值不匹配的问题,确保游戏的正常运行。

游戏文件哈希值不匹配,常见原因及解决方法游戏文件哈希值不匹配,

发表评论